Liverpool are now waiting to see what an international star's final decision is ahead of a potential transfer.

Will Liverpool sign Denzel Dumfries? That was the big question back in January and it's one that, apparently, remains relevant.

L'Interista reports that the full-back-slash-wing-back could be on the move this summer if he wants to be. And it really is now Dumfries' decision.

There's a €25m release clause in his contract, meaning Inter don't actually have a say here. Dumfries is able to depart for one of the many clubs hoping to snap him up, Liverpool included.

But Inter aren't giving up. They've offered Dumfries a contract extension with a payrise - as long as he also agrees to remove that release clause.

If the player says no, then the likes of Liverpool are able to sign him this summer. Inter will hope that his decision is to remain put on more money - but the Reds could secure a proper bargain here if Dumfries feels it's the right time to move on.

Serie A Performance and Injury Return

Denzel Dumfries has endured a challenging 2025–2026 season at Inter Milan, largely due to a significant ankle injury that sidelined him for over three months. As of April 8, 2026, the 29-year-old Dutch wing-back has recently returned to full fitness, marking his 200th appearance for the Nerazzurri in a victory over Roma. Despite his lengthy absence, he remains an important tactical asset, contributing one goal in Serie A and two in the Champions League this term. His physical dominance and work rate on the right flank continue to be key features of his game, though his offensive output has been limited compared to previous seasons as he regains his competitive rhythm.

Contract Status and Transfer Speculation

Dumfries’ future at the San Siro is subject to intense speculation as the summer 2026 transfer window approaches. While he is officially under contract until June 2028, reports on April 1 indicate that his representatives have offered his services to several Premier League clubs, including Liverpool, Manchester United, and Chelsea. The presence of a reported £21 million release clause has made him an attractive target for teams seeking experienced defensive reinforcements. Inter is reportedly open to a sale to help lower the average age of their squad, but they are also attempting to negotiate new terms to remove the clause. Dumfries remains focused on the Serie A title run-in before making a final decision on his next career step.
